- Course Content
In this course the following topics will be covered: general valuation principle, valuation of bonds, stocks and investment projects with the calculation of net cashflows and equivalent annual cost; introduction to risk and return, portfolio theory and the Capital Asset Pricing Model, risk and the cost of capital; introduction to international finance with exchange risk management. Possibly, also a guest lecture will be organized about a theme to be announced.

- Learning Outcomes
-
General competencies
The purpose of this course is to provide students a thorough understanding of the fundamental concepts and techniques in the areas of financial management and investment analysis.
